Does this theme allow video inserted into the pages? If so, how would you lay it out?
Hi NYMills
Yes Picks does allow for videos. There is a video embed field that is included in each post.
The video will output at the top of each post in place of where the feature image is.
Hope that helps, if you have any other questions please let me know.

Is ‘album’ a custom post type? Basically, within an album post I’m curious if I’ll be able to add text in addition to photos. TIA
Hi Jeremy
Yes, albums is a post type. You can add descriptions to the photos individually or add a block of copy at the bottom of the album using the WYSIWYG
Hope that helps, if you have any other questions please let me know.
